Sledding
The local children’s sledding hill, known as Vinegar Hill, has been Ouray’s sledding hill for over 100 years. It is located on the east side of town between Fifth and Sixth Avenue. The top and bottom of Fifth Street, between these two avenues, is blocked off with hay bales to driving traffic.
In addition to this in-town sledding hill, a short drive from Ouray in either direction offers unlimited sledding in some of the most spectacular mountains you’ll ever see.
If you didn’t bring a sled you can purchase an inexpensive plastic one from several of Ouray’s shops. For the more serious sledder, check out Ouray Mountain Sports for hand made wood sleds from Silverton. A large piece of cardboard works well too!
